FDA on Friday (Oct. 4) published another chapter in its multi-chapter draft guidance on risk-based preventive controls for human food. The latest chapter, chapter 14, explains how food facilities subject to Food Safety Modernization Act (FSMA) requirements can establish and implement written recall plans, the agency said. Chapter 14, FDA said on Friday, is intended to help food facilities comply with the preventive controls for human food rule mandated by FSMA.
